	 <t>In general, linear network coding can improve the network communication performance in terms of throughput, latency, and reliability.  BATched Sparse (BATS) code is a class of efficient linear network coding scheme with a matrix generalization of fountain codes as the outer code and batch-based linear network coding as the inner code.  This document describes a baseline BATS coding scheme for communication through multi-hop networks and discusses the related research issues towards a more sophisticated BATS coding scheme.  This document is a product of the Coding for Efficient Network Communications Research Group (NWCRG).
